Role Description
The Accessibility Coordinator will take ownership of all aspects of Accessibility at our events; from handling customer enquiries and applications for essential companion tickets, to liaising with our Production teams and on-site contractors to make sure our Accessibility customers have the best experience possible at our events. The overriding goal of this role is to ensure that all our events are accessible to all customers.
The role will include collaborative working with internal stakeholders and third-party partners - for this role you will need to be comfortable working to tight deadlines, have great attention to detail and written and oral communication skills, and be comfortable working with various digital platforms.

What the role includes
+ Contribute to the planning, writing, and reviewing all aspects of Accessibility information for all festival websites and the Accessibility Customer Database, including customer information sheets, newsletters, and application closing date reminders
+ Liaising with the Production Teams to ensure that all accessible facilities are booked in advance, and installed correctly on site, as per the agreed location and specification, with support from the Accessibility Assistant
+ Check and communicate an up-to-date list of the numbers of accessibility customers attending each event and sharing updates weekly (or as required) with the Event Manager for the festival
+ Working alongside the Head of Accessibility to recruit and manage the on-site Accessibility Team for each event, which runs the customer check-in, manages the information tent and all of the campsite and arena accessible facilities
+ Delivering on-site briefings to teams such as the accessibility team, stewards, and security
+ Liaising with our partners who provide services such as performance interpretation to plan on-site activities
+ Debriefing, and reviewing each festival with the accessibility and production teams
+ Producing a debrief and having an input to the accessibility improvement plan following each event
+ Looking at solutions to constantly improve and expand the services and facilities offered to our customers, to ensure our events are inclusive and are accessible to all customers
